What is Forged Carbon Fiber?
Known for its distinct manufacturing process, this type of carbon fiber is created by molding short carbon fiber strands in a resin matrix under high pressure. This results in a material that is not only lightweight but also incredibly strong and versatile.

In contrast, traditional carbon fiber, often referred to as woven carbon fiber, consists of long strands woven together in a fabric-like structure. This method allows for great flexibility and strength but also requires more complex handling and manufacturing processes.
Key Differences of Forged Carbon Fiber vs. Carbon Fiber
- Manufacturing Process: Forged carbon fiber’s molding process allows for simpler manufacturing compared to traditional carbon fibers that need weaving and more intricate layering.
- Strength and Durability: While both materials boast high tensile strength, forged carbon fiber is known for its improved impact resistance due to its layered structure.
- Customization: The flexibility of the manufacturing process for forged carbon fiber enables it to be shaped into more complex forms without compromising structural integrity.
- Aesthetics: Forged carbon fiber often has a more random, unique appearance, which can be visually appealing for design-oriented products.
- Cost: Generally, the manufacturing processes for traditional carbon fiber can be more expensive due to the time-intensive weaving and layering, making forged carbon fiber a more cost-effective option for certain applications.
